Captured media refers to information types that are obtained or recorded from the real world, such as still pictures, moving pictures, and sound. This term is used to describe media content that is not artificially created or synthesized, but rather captured through various means like cameras, microphones, or other recording devices. It encompasses any form of media that has been captured or recorded from its original source, whether it be images, videos, or audio recordings.

Synthesized Media refers to information types that are created or generated by computers, such as text, graphics, and computer animation. This term is used to describe media content that is not directly captured from the real world but is instead produced artificially using computer algorithms and software. It encompasses various forms of digital media that are generated or simulated by computers, allowing for the creation of virtual environments, special effects, and computer-generated imagery.

Discrete media refers to media that only involves space dimension, such as still images, text, and graphics. It is also known as static media, non-time-based media, non-temporal media, or space-based media.

Continuous media refers to time-based media such as sound, moving images, and animation. It is also known as dynamic media or temporal media.
